You can create a new derived field by basing it on an existing
derived field, then changing the expression.
About this task
Only fields from tables that are selected in the process
configuration dialog can be used in a derived field expression. If
a desired table does not appear, make sure it is selected as a source
table.
Procedure
-
From the configuration window of a process that supports derived fields, click
Derived fields.
The Create Derived Field dialog opens.
-
From the Field name list, select an existing derived field.
The expression for the selected field appears in the Expression area.
- Change the name of the existing derived field to the name
that you want to use for the new derived field.
Important: You cannot use the words "Yes" or "No" as names for
derived fields. Doing so results in database disconnects when these
derived fields are called.
- Edit the derived field expression.
- Click OK.
